Raptor is a C library providing a set of parsers and serializers for
Resource Description Framework (RDF) triples by parsing syntaxes or
serializing the triples into a syntax.
.
The parsing syntaxes are RDF/JSON, RDF/XML, N-Triples, Turtle, GRDDL and RSS
tag soup including Atom 0.3 and Atom 1.0. The serializing syntaxes
are RDF/XML, N-Quads, N-Triples RSS 1.0 and Atom 1.0. Raptor can handle
RDF/XML as used by RDF applications such as RSS 1.0, FOAF, DOAP,
Dublin Core and OWL.
.
Raptor is designed for performance, flexibility and embedding (no
memory leaks) and to closely match the revised RDF/XML specification.

This package provides the rapper tool for validating, parsing and
serializing RDF/XML, N-Triples, Turtle, RSS, Atom and other Resource
Description Framework (RDF) syntaxes using the Raptor RDF library.
